Join for a day of performance, healing, and celebration — through words, sound, and voice. Whether you speak one language, two, or something in-between, Tongues is for you.

Tongues is more than a performance — it’s a bilingual gathering, an offering, a space to honor your mother tongues, your migration stories, and the in-betweens.

We spent 3 months developing community workshops at university settlement community centers and senior centers. And we created this performance with and for communities in Chinatown, New York.
